Job summary

Locum Consultant in the department of MSK Radiology This a 10PA locum appointment for X2 Consultant Radiologist, with special interests in MSK Radiology. This posts will be available from 1.9.26 for a period of 6 months This posts will deliver 10 PAs supporting the Leeds MSK Radiology team (Dr Bill Pass, Dr Philip Robinson), and supporting the Leeds Consultant MSK Radiologists and team. The post-holders will provide musculoskeletal radiology and MSK interventional radiology services. There will be opportunities to contribute to research and and teaching. The post will be based at Chapel Allerton Hospital/Leeds General Infirmary.

Main duties of the job

These are X2 10 PA locum appointments for Consultant Radiologists, with special interests in Musculoskeletal Radiology. This posts will deliver 10 PAs supporting the MSK Radiology team (Dr Bill Pass, Dr James Baren, Dr Dominic Barron, Dr Richard Fawcett, Dr Harun Gupta, Dr Michelle Ooi, Dr Samir Paruthikunnan, Dr James Rankine, Dr Philip Robinson, Dr Emma Rowbotham and Dr Fern Whittam. The successful applicants should hold accreditation in FRCR in the Royal College of Radiologists or equivalent, and should be on the Specialist Register or within six months of being admitted to the Register for trainees if currently in a training programme within the UK, or have references which have been authorised by the Deputy Medical Director and Clinical Director. Applicants should have established skills in MSK Imaging, Interventional, CT/MR and Trauma Imaging. Excellent communication and team working skills, a strong commitment to teaching and service development are essential. Consideration will be given to applicants who wish to work full or part time and those wishing to job share. What you will bring to the role

There will be ample opportunities to contribute to research, teaching and new developments within the department. The post holders will be encouraged to facilitate and contribute to the current clinical research programs ongoing in the department.

In addition, contribute to formal specialist trainee teaching within the Yorkshire Radiology Academy and contribute to the clinical supervision and training of specialist trainees and clinical fellows in MSK and interventional radiology.

There will be a requirement to attend and lead multi-disciplinary meetings, contribute to audit and assist non-medical staff in their roles in the department
